Biopsychosocial Model
An interdisciplinary model that examines the interconnection between biology, psychology, and socio-environmental factors in understanding health and illness.
Selye's GAS Model
A three-stage theory (General Adaptation Syndrome) that explains the physiological changes the body goes through when under stress.
Biopsychological Model
An approach in psychology that examines psychological disorders and behaviors through biological, psychological, and social factors.
Lazarus and Folkman's Psychological Model
A model suggesting that stress is a result of an individual's perception of a situation and their assessment of their resources to manage the stressor.
